Senior Software Engineer, Backend (Consumer - CETI)
Senior Software Engineer, Backend (Consumer - CETI)

Senior Software Engineer, Backend (Consumer - CETI)

Berlin Vollzeit 111600 - 130700 € / Jahr (geschätzt) Kein Home Office möglich
Go Premium
Coinbase

Auf einen Blick

  • Aufgaben: Entwickle und skaliere automatisierte Testinfrastrukturen für hochwertige Produkte.
  • Arbeitgeber: Coinbase fördert wirtschaftliche Freiheit durch innovative Blockchain-Technologie.
  • Mitarbeitervorteile: Attraktives Gehalt, Boni, Aktienoptionen und umfassende Gesundheitsleistungen.
  • Warum dieser Job: Gestalte die Zukunft des Finanzsystems und arbeite mit talentierten Kollegen.
  • Gewünschte Qualifikationen: Mindestens 5 Jahre Erfahrung in der Softwareentwicklung und Kenntnisse in Testmethoden.
  • Andere Informationen: Vielfältige Unternehmenskultur und Engagement für Chancengleichheit.

Das voraussichtliche Gehalt liegt zwischen 111600 - 130700 € pro Jahr.

Bereit, über das hinauszugehen, was Sie für möglich halten? Bei Coinbase ist es unsere Mission, die wirtschaftliche Freiheit in der Welt zu erhöhen. Es ist eine massive, ehrgeizige Gelegenheit, die jeden Tag das Beste von uns verlangt, während wir die aufkommende Onchain-Plattform und damit das zukünftige globale Finanzsystem aufbauen. Um unsere Mission zu erreichen, suchen wir einen sehr spezifischen Kandidaten. Wir möchten jemanden, der leidenschaftlich an unserer Mission interessiert ist und an die Kraft von Krypto- und Blockchain-Technologie glaubt, um das Finanzsystem zu aktualisieren. Wir suchen jemanden, der bereit ist, seinen Einfluss auf die Welt auszuüben, der den Druck und das Privileg schätzt, mit hochqualifizierten Kollegen zu arbeiten, und der aktiv nach Feedback sucht, um sich ständig weiterzuentwickeln. Wir suchen jemanden, der sich den schwierigsten Problemen des Unternehmens stellt.

Die Consumer Product Group baut die nachhaltigen Wachstumsmaschinen für Coinbase, die offenen Finanzdienstleistungen für 1 Milliarde Menschen mit Produkten wie Advanced Trading, Staking und Coinbase One bereitstellen. Die Ingenieure für Verbraucherprodukte streben danach, die Coinbase Retail-App zur benutzerfreundlichsten, schnellsten und sichersten Erfahrung für alle weltweit zu machen, um auf die Kryptoökonomie zuzugreifen und daran teilzunehmen. Dies sind Echtzeitanwendungen mit hoher Frequenz, niedrigen Latenzaktualisierungen, auf der sichersten, dockerisierten Infrastruktur, die in der Cloud läuft. Unser Team konzentriert sich darauf, die Entwicklung hochwertiger Produkte zu beschleunigen, indem es die Validierung von Produktverhalten im großen Maßstab durch automatisierte Testinfrastruktur ermöglicht. Wir sind vollständig ingenieurgesteuert und identifizieren Möglichkeiten, innovative Tools und Infrastrukturen zu entwickeln, um Entwicklern zu ermöglichen, hochpräzise Produktionsverhalten während der Entwicklung zu testen, um Fehler so früh wie möglich im Entwicklungszyklus zu erkennen und zu beheben.

Wir suchen erfahrene und dynamische Backend-Software-Ingenieure, die unserem Consumer Engineering Test Infrastructure-Team beitreten. Diese Rolle ist entscheidend für die Entwicklung robuster, benutzerfreundlicher Infrastrukturen, die es Ingenieuren ermöglichen, hochwertige Produkte zu liefern, und für die Etablierung einer Kultur des proaktiven Testens innerhalb unserer Organisation. Der ideale Kandidat wird verantwortlich sein für die Entwicklung von Testinfrastrukturen und die Förderung der Testautomatisierung über unsere Dienste hinweg.

Was Sie tun werden (d.h. Aufgaben):

  • Testinfrastruktur aufbauen und skalieren: Automatisierte Testframeworks von Grund auf entwerfen und implementieren, um Teams zu ermöglichen, das Produktverhalten schneller und zuverlässiger zu validieren.
  • Intelligente Automatisierung ermöglichen: Strategien definieren, um Tests auf jeder Ebene – Unit, Integration und End-to-End – zu automatisieren und nahtlos in CI/CD-Pipelines zu integrieren.
  • AI/ML für intelligentere Tests nutzen: Neuartige AI/ML-Techniken erkunden und implementieren, um die Testausführung zu optimieren, fehlerhafte Tests zu erkennen und selbstheilende Automatisierung zu ermöglichen.
  • Entwicklerproduktivität steigern: Engpässe in den Testabläufen identifizieren, modernste Tools einführen und optimierte Prozesse schaffen, die Ingenieuren helfen, hochwertige Software mit Vertrauen zu liefern.
  • Produktqualitätsmetriken definieren und vorantreiben: Messbare Treiber- und Ergebnismetriken festlegen, die die Testeffektivität, die Stabilität der Veröffentlichung und die Effizienz der Entwickler verfolgen.
  • Best Practices und unternehmensweite Auswirkungen vorantreiben: Mit Teams über den gesamten Tech-Stack hinweg zusammenarbeiten, um skalierbare Teststrategien zu definieren und umzusetzen. Ihre Arbeit wird die Entwicklungsgeschwindigkeit und die Produktqualität im gesamten Unternehmen direkt beeinflussen.

Was wir in Ihnen suchen:

  • Sie haben mindestens 5 Jahre Erfahrung in der Softwareentwicklung.
  • Sie haben Produktionsdienste entworfen, gebaut, skaliert und gewartet und wissen, wie man eine serviceorientierte Architektur zusammensetzt.
  • Sie verstehen die Testbarkeit von Systemen und haben gute Kenntnisse über Testmethoden und Best Practices für funktionale und nicht-funktionale Anforderungen, die Sie für weit verbreitete Produkte verwendet und entwickelt haben.
  • Sie schreiben hochwertigen, gut getesteten Code, um die Bedürfnisse Ihrer Kunden zu erfüllen.
  • Sie sind leidenschaftlich daran interessiert, ein offenes Finanzsystem aufzubauen, das die Welt zusammenbringt.

Schön zu haben:

  • Sie haben ein schnelles Wachstum in Ihrem Unternehmen durchlaufen (von einem Startup zu einem mittelständischen Unternehmen).
  • Erfahrung mit Wachstumsversuchen oder A/B-Testframeworks.
  • Sie haben Erfahrung darin, ein großes Monolith in Mikrodienste zu zerlegen.
  • Sie haben mit Golang, Ruby, Docker, Rails, Postgres, MongoDB oder DynamoDB gearbeitet.
  • Sie haben Finanz-, Hochverfügbarkeits- oder Sicherheitssysteme entwickelt.
  • Sie haben Erfahrung mit Blockchain-Technologie (wie Bitcoin, Ethereum usw.).
  • Krypto-orientierte Erfahrung, einschließlich Vertrautheit mit Onchain-Aktivitäten wie der Interaktion mit Ethereum-Adressen, der Verwendung von ENS und der Interaktion mit dApps oder blockchain-basierten Diensten.

Hinweis zur Gehaltstransparenz: Je nach Arbeitsort kann das angestrebte Jahresgehalt für diese Position wie unten angegeben variieren. Vollzeitangebote von Coinbase beinhalten auch Zielboni + Zielaktien + Leistungen (einschließlich medizinischer, zahnärztlicher, augenärztlicher Versorgung und 401(k)). Gehaltsbereich: $186,005 — $218,900 USD.

Engagement für Chancengleichheit: Coinbase setzt sich für Vielfalt in seiner Belegschaft ein und ist stolz darauf, ein Arbeitgeber für Chancengleichheit zu sein. Alle qualifizierten Bewerber erhalten unabhängig von Rasse, Hautfarbe, Religion, Glauben, Geschlecht, nationaler Herkunft, Alter, Behinderung, Veteranenstatus, Geschlecht, Geschlechtsausdruck oder -identität, sexueller Orientierung oder einem anderen durch geltendes Recht geschützten Grund Berücksichtigung für eine Anstellung.

Senior Software Engineer, Backend (Consumer - CETI) Arbeitgeber: Coinbase

Coinbase ist ein hervorragender Arbeitgeber, der eine dynamische und innovative Arbeitsumgebung bietet, in der Mitarbeiter die Möglichkeit haben, an der Spitze der Blockchain-Technologie zu arbeiten. Mit einem starken Fokus auf persönliche und berufliche Weiterentwicklung, einer offenen Unternehmenskultur und der Chance, an bedeutenden Projekten zu arbeiten, die das Finanzsystem der Zukunft gestalten, ist Coinbase der ideale Ort für leidenschaftliche Software-Ingenieure, die einen echten Unterschied machen möchten. Darüber hinaus profitieren Mitarbeiter von attraktiven Vergütungsmodellen, umfassenden Sozialleistungen und einem engagierten Team, das Vielfalt und Inklusion schätzt.
Coinbase

Kontaktperson:

Coinbase HR Team

StudySmarter Bewerbungstipps 🤫

So bekommst du den Job: Senior Software Engineer, Backend (Consumer - CETI)

Tip Nummer 1

Zeige deine Leidenschaft für Blockchain und Kryptowährungen in Gesprächen. Informiere dich über aktuelle Trends und Entwicklungen in der Branche, um während des Interviews fundierte Diskussionen führen zu können.

Tip Nummer 2

Netzwerke mit anderen Fachleuten in der Branche, insbesondere auf Plattformen wie LinkedIn oder in speziellen Foren. Der Austausch mit Gleichgesinnten kann dir wertvolle Einblicke geben und möglicherweise sogar Empfehlungen für offene Stellen bei Coinbase bringen.

Tip Nummer 3

Bereite dich darauf vor, konkrete Beispiele für deine Erfahrungen mit Testautomatisierung und CI/CD-Pipelines zu teilen. Zeige, wie du in der Vergangenheit Probleme gelöst hast und welche Tools du verwendet hast, um die Effizienz zu steigern.

Tip Nummer 4

Sei bereit, Fragen zu beantworten, die deine Fähigkeit zur Zusammenarbeit mit verschiedenen Teams betreffen. Betone deine Erfahrungen in interdisziplinären Projekten und wie du dazu beigetragen hast, die Produktqualität zu verbessern.

Diese Fähigkeiten machen dich zur top Bewerber*in für die Stelle: Senior Software Engineer, Backend (Consumer - CETI)

Software Engineering
Testautomatisierung
Architektur von Testinfrastrukturen
CI/CD-Pipelines
AI/ML-Techniken
Anomalieerkennung
Entwicklung von Testframeworks
Serviceorientierte Architektur
Testing-Methodologien
Code-Qualität
Entwicklerproduktivität
Produktqualitätsmetriken
Zusammenarbeit mit funktionsübergreifenden Teams
Golang
Ruby
Docker
Postgres
MongoDB
DynamoDB
Blockchain-Technologie
Kryptowährungskenntnisse

Tipps für deine Bewerbung 🫡

Verstehe die Unternehmensmission: Informiere dich über die Mission von Coinbase und wie sie die wirtschaftliche Freiheit fördern wollen. Zeige in deiner Bewerbung, dass du diese Vision teilst und leidenschaftlich an der Weiterentwicklung des Finanzsystems interessiert bist.

Hebe relevante Erfahrungen hervor: Betone deine mindestens 5-jährige Erfahrung in der Softwareentwicklung, insbesondere in Bezug auf das Design und die Implementierung von Produktionsdiensten. Stelle sicher, dass du konkrete Beispiele für deine Arbeit mit Testmethoden und -praktiken angibst.

Zeige deine technischen Fähigkeiten: Liste spezifische Technologien und Tools auf, mit denen du gearbeitet hast, wie Golang, Docker oder Blockchain-Technologien. Dies zeigt, dass du die technischen Anforderungen der Stelle verstehst und erfüllst.

Füge eine persönliche Note hinzu: Erkläre, warum du dich für diese Position interessierst und was dich motiviert, Teil des Teams zu werden. Deine Begeisterung für die Krypto- und Blockchain-Technologie sollte klar erkennbar sein.

Wie du dich auf ein Vorstellungsgespräch bei Coinbase vorbereitest

Verstehe die Mission von Coinbase

Bereite dich darauf vor, über die Mission von Coinbase zu sprechen und wie du dazu beitragen kannst, wirtschaftliche Freiheit zu fördern. Zeige deine Leidenschaft für Krypto und Blockchain-Technologie und erkläre, warum du an diese Technologien glaubst.

Technische Fähigkeiten demonstrieren

Sei bereit, deine technischen Fähigkeiten zu zeigen, insbesondere in Bezug auf Testautomatisierung und Infrastruktur. Bereite Beispiele aus deiner bisherigen Arbeit vor, die deine Erfahrung mit der Entwicklung von Testframeworks und CI/CD-Pipelines verdeutlichen.

Fragen zur Teamarbeit vorbereiten

Da die Rolle eine enge Zusammenarbeit mit verschiedenen Teams erfordert, solltest du Fragen zur Teamarbeit und zur Zusammenarbeit vorbereiten. Überlege dir, wie du in der Vergangenheit erfolgreich mit anderen zusammengearbeitet hast, um Probleme zu lösen oder Projekte voranzutreiben.

Kreative Problemlösungsansätze präsentieren

Coinbase sucht nach jemandem, der Herausforderungen aktiv angeht. Bereite dich darauf vor, spezifische Beispiele zu nennen, bei denen du innovative Lösungen für komplexe Probleme gefunden hast, und zeige, wie du dabei Feedback genutzt hast, um dich weiterzuentwickeln.

Senior Software Engineer, Backend (Consumer - CETI)
Coinbase
Standort: Berlin
Premium gehen

Schneller zum Traumjob mit Premium

Deine Bewerbung wird als „Top Bewerbung“ bei unseren Partnern gekennzeichnet
Individuelles Feedback zu Lebenslauf und Anschreiben, einschließlich der Anpassung an spezifische Stellenanforderungen
Gehöre zu den ersten Bewerbern für neue Stellen mit unserem AI Bewerbungsassistenten
1:1 Unterstützung und Karriereberatung durch unsere Career Coaches
Premium gehen

Geld-zurück-Garantie, wenn du innerhalb von 6 Monaten keinen Job findest

>